WHAT IS A CREATIVE DIRECTOR COPY JOB?

A creative director copy job is a specialized position within the advertising and marketing industry. As the title suggests, a creative director copy is responsible for overseeing and directing the creative aspects of a company's copywriting team. This role involves developing and implementing creative strategies to effectively communicate a brand's message through various forms of copy, such as advertisements, website content, social media posts, and more. The creative director copy plays a crucial role in shaping the overall brand identity and ensuring that the copy aligns with the brand's values and objectives.

WHAT DO PEOPLE USUALLY DO IN THIS POSITION?

In a creative director copy position, individuals are responsible for managing and leading a team of copywriters. They collaborate closely with other departments, such as marketing, design, and client services, to develop creative concepts and strategies. The creative director copy provides guidance and feedback to the copywriters, ensuring that the copy meets the brand's standards and resonates with the target audience. They also conduct research to stay updated on market trends and consumer preferences, allowing them to create compelling and effective copy that drives engagement and conversions.

HOW TO BECOME A CREATIVE DIRECTOR COPY

To become a creative director copy, it is essential to have a strong foundation in copywriting and marketing. Many individuals start their careers as copywriters, honing their writing skills and gaining experience in the industry. As they progress, they can take on leadership roles within copywriting teams and eventually advance to the position of a creative director copy. Apart from gaining practical experience, pursuing a relevant degree in advertising, marketing, or communications can provide a solid educational background. Continuous learning and staying updated on industry trends and emerging technologies are also crucial for success in this role. Building a strong portfolio showcasing your creative copywriting skills and demonstrating your ability to lead a team can significantly enhance your chances of becoming a creative director copy.

AVERAGE SALARY

The average salary for a creative director copy can vary depending on factors such as location, industry, and years of experience. According to data from the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for advertising and promotions managers, which includes creative directors, was $135,900 as of May 2020. However, it is important to note that salaries can range significantly, with highly experienced and successful creative directors earning substantially more.

WHAT ARE THE TYPICAL TOOLS USED BY CREATIVE DIRECTORS COPY?

Creative directors copy utilize various tools and software to enhance their work and streamline the creative process. Some of the typical tools used include: 1. Project Management Software: This helps creative directors organize and track the progress of various projects, assign tasks to team members, and ensure deadlines are met. 2. Collaboration Tools: Platforms like Google Drive, Slack, and Trello facilitate seamless communication and collaboration among team members, allowing for efficient workflow and idea sharing. 3. Design Software: Knowledge of design software such as Adobe Creative Suite can be beneficial for creative directors copy, as they may need to work closely with designers to bring their creative concepts to life. 4. Analytics Tools: Creative directors copy often rely on analytics tools to track the performance of their copy and campaigns, enabling them to make data-driven decisions and optimize their strategies. 5. Social Media Management Tools: As social media plays a significant role in copywriting and marketing, creative directors may utilize tools like Hootsuite or Buffer to schedule and manage social media content.
